/* * libnogg: a decoder library for Ogg Vorbis streams * Copyright (c) 2014-2024 Andrew Church * * This software may be copied and redistributed under certain conditions; * see the file "COPYING" in the source code distribution for details. * NO WARRANTY is provided with this software. */ #include "include/nogg.h" #include "tests/common.h" static int bad_call_count; // Neither of these should be called. static void *dummy_malloc(void *opaque, int32_t size, int32_t align) { bad_call_count++; return NULL; } static void dummy_free(void *opaque, void *ptr) { bad_call_count++; } int main(void) { FILE *f; uint8_t *data; long size; EXPECT(f = fopen("tests/data/square.ogg", "rb")); EXPECT_EQ(fseek(f, 0, SEEK_END), 0); EXPECT_GT(size = ftell(f), 0); EXPECT_EQ(fseek(f, 0, SEEK_SET), 0); EXPECT(data = malloc(size)); EXPECT_EQ(fread(data, 1, size, f), size); fclose(f); const int ofs_id = 0x1C; const int len_id = 0x1E; const int ofs_setup = 0xB9; const int len_setup = 0x9AC; EXPECT_MEMEQ(data+ofs_id, "\x01vorbis", 7); EXPECT_MEMEQ(data+ofs_setup, "\x05vorbis", 7); vorbis_callbacks_t callbacks = {.malloc = NULL, .free = NULL}; vorbis_error_t error; error = (vorbis_error_t)-1; EXPECT_FALSE(vorbis_open_packet(NULL, len_id, data+ofs_setup, len_setup, callbacks, NULL, 0, &error)); EXPECT_EQ(error, VORBIS_ERROR_INVALID_ARGUMENT); error = (vorbis_error_t)-1; EXPECT_FALSE(vorbis_open_packet(data+ofs_id, 0, data+ofs_setup, len_setup, callbacks, NULL, 0, &error)); EXPECT_EQ(error, VORBIS_ERROR_INVALID_ARGUMENT); error = (vorbis_error_t)-1; EXPECT_FALSE(vorbis_open_packet(data+ofs_id, -1, data+ofs_setup, len_setup, callbacks, NULL, 0, &error)); EXPECT_EQ(error, VORBIS_ERROR_INVALID_ARGUMENT); error = (vorbis_error_t)-1; EXPECT_FALSE(vorbis_open_packet(data+ofs_id, len_id, NULL, len_setup, callbacks, NULL, 0, &error)); EXPECT_EQ(error, VORBIS_ERROR_INVALID_ARGUMENT); error = (vorbis_error_t)-1; EXPECT_FALSE(vorbis_open_packet(data+ofs_id, len_id, data+ofs_setup, 0, callbacks, NULL, 0, &error)); EXPECT_EQ(error, VORBIS_ERROR_INVALID_ARGUMENT); error = (vorbis_error_t)-1; EXPECT_FALSE(vorbis_open_packet(data+ofs_id, len_id, data+ofs_setup, -1, callbacks, NULL, 0, &error)); EXPECT_EQ(error, VORBIS_ERROR_INVALID_ARGUMENT); callbacks.malloc = dummy_malloc; error = (vorbis_error_t)-1; EXPECT_FALSE(vorbis_open_packet(data+ofs_id, len_id, data+ofs_setup, len_setup, callbacks, NULL, 0, &error)); EXPECT_EQ(error, VORBIS_ERROR_INVALID_ARGUMENT); EXPECT_EQ(bad_call_count, 0); callbacks.malloc = NULL; callbacks.free = dummy_free; error = (vorbis_error_t)-1; EXPECT_FALSE(vorbis_open_packet(data+ofs_id, len_id, data+ofs_setup, len_setup, callbacks, NULL, 0, &error)); EXPECT_EQ(error, VORBIS_ERROR_INVALID_ARGUMENT); EXPECT_EQ(bad_call_count, 0); free(data); return EXIT_SUCCESS; }
